Houston Man Dies After Medical Emergency in Jail Cell

On Monday, August 12, 2024, at 2:57 p.m., Hugo Mota, 41, was pronounced deceased at St. Joseph Hospital. Mota experienced a medical emergency in his cellblock and was initially treated by medical personnel at the clinic. Houston Fire Department EMS transported him to St. Joseph Hospital, where he was pronounced dead.

The Texas Commission on Jail Standards has been notified of Mota’s death. The Houston Police Department is conducting an investigation, as required by state law for all jail-related deaths. Additionally, the Harris County Sheriff’s Office Internal Affairs Division is reviewing whether all relevant policies and procedures were adhered to.

The Harris County Institute of Forensic Sciences will perform an autopsy to determine the cause of death.
